I Don’t Always Attend Beer Festivals, But When I Do….

At the first mention of “Mexico,” ones thoughts instantly turn to “cerveza!” Mexico has recently overtaken Germany in beer production to become the fourth largest brewer in the world. Beer production was up 8% last year. Of course, much of this is attributed to the duopoly of the two well-known Mexican brands, Continue reading